首頁  >  文章  >  開發工具  >  討論GitLab中修改使用者權限的檔案位置

討論GitLab中修改使用者權限的檔案位置

PHPz
PHPz原創
2023-03-31 09:20:001207瀏覽

在GitLab中,管理員和專案擁有者可以修改使用者的權限。這可以幫助他們控制專案和資源的存取等級。在本文中,我們將討論GitLab中修改使用者權限的檔案位置。

首先,讓我們先簡單了解GitLab的權限模型。 GitLab使用Role-Based Access Control(RBAC)模型,其中每個使用者都分配了一個或多個角色。這些角色定義了使用者在專案中的權限等級。例如,管理員角色具有對所有專案的完全存取權限,而開發人員角色則只能存取特定專案的程式碼庫。

現在,讓我們來看看在GitLab中如何修改使用者權限。若要修改使用者權限,請執行下列步驟:

  1. 登入GitLab,然後進入需要修改使用者權限的項目。
  2. 點選項目選單中的「Settings」選項。
  3. 在「Settings」頁面中,選擇「Members」標籤。這裡列出了目前專案中的所有成員及其角色。
  4. 找到您要修改權限的用戶,並按一下其名稱。
  5. 在使用者詳細資料頁面中,您可以變更其角色並指定其他權限等級。
  6. 確認更改並儲存使用者詳細資料頁面。

此時,GitLab會自動更新該使用者在專案中的權限等級。

現在,讓我們來看看在GitLab的檔案系統中,到底在哪裡可以找到這些權限檔。

在GitLab中,每個專案都有一個.gitlab-ci.yml文件,它包含專案的所有CI / CD配置。此文件定義瞭如何構建,測試和部署程式碼。此外,它還包含有關每個作業運行的環境變數以及每個作業的運行順序和依賴關係等資訊。

如果您要修改使用者權限,可以透過以下步驟找到此檔案:

  1. 登入GitLab帳戶,並進入您想要修改使用者權限的專案。
  2. 在專案導覽選單中點選「CI / CD」。
  3. 在 CI / CD 頁面中,您可以看到一個「YAML」標籤頁。點擊它以查看該專案的.gitlab-ci.yml檔案。
  4. 點擊「編輯」按鈕,它會將您帶到YAML編輯器中。在這裡,您可以修改檔案以更改使用者權限。

值得注意的是,您需要具有管理員或專案擁有者的權限才能修改此檔案。如果您不具備此權限,則無法編輯該檔案。

總而言之,在GitLab中修改使用者權限是一項重要的任務。它有助於控制專案的存取級別,保護敏感資訊,並確保專案的機密性。雖然這項任務有些複雜,但是遵循上述步驟,您可以輕鬆修改使用者的權限等級。

以上是討論GitLab中修改使用者權限的檔案位置的詳細內容。更多資訊請關注PHP中文網其他相關文章!

陳述:
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n